The Pearce Mustangs will head out to square off against the Flower Mound Jaguars at 7:00 p.m. on Monday. The last three games Pearce has played have been within two runs, so don't be surprised if it's a close one.
Pearce took a 15-run defeat the last time they faced off against Princeton, but this time they managed to keep it close and that made all the difference. The Mustangs skirted past the Panthers 7-6. The win was a breath of fresh air for the Mustangs as it put an end to their six-game losing streak.
Saylor Jackson made a big impact no matter where she played. She pitched four innings while giving up just two earned (and four unearned) runs off four hits. Jackson was also stellar in the batter's box, going a perfect 2-for-2 with two stolen bases, two runs, and two RBI.
In other batting news, Ashlyn Yarbrough was incredible, going 1-for-3 with one home run and four RBI. Another player making a difference was Alexa Falk, who went 1-for-3 with two runs, one triple, and one RBI.
Flower Mound played against Plano on Saturday and lost via forfeit.
Pearce's record is now 4-7. As for Flower Mound, their loss dropped their record down to 4-4.
